Employment Verification is routinely one of the biggest hassles that human resources employees face on a regular basis. Between inaccurate information and companies unwilling to return phone calls or answer emails, an average human resources employee can spend up to eight hours, out of a forty hour week, chasing down the employment verifications, in order to keep the hiring process running smoothly. This amounts to about twenty percent of an employee’s time. Any potential savings in this area are sure to be welcomed by managers across the country.
Recently, a company called VeraTrack introduced a revolutionary and proprietary system that uses technology, and an automated system, to drastically reduce the workload that Employment Verification presents. All a company has to do is log in, enter the identifying information of both the company and the applicant, enter the information to be verified, and simply wait. The system sends a notification to the previous company, requesting that they log on (using a secure verification code) and complete the necessary information. Once this is done, the hiring company is notified, and the job is done.
If you are a large corporation and intend to this system often, your costs should start at under $5 per verification. If you are a smaller company that requires less usage of this system, you can expect to pay around $7 to $9 per verification.
